Chien, Yie W.

Novel drug delivery systems Yie W. Chien. - New York Informa 2011 - vii, 797p: ill; 26 cm - (Drugs and the pharmaceutical sciences; v.50). .

9780824785208


Drugs - Controlled release Drug delivery systems.

615.6 / C34N